在js中, ==是一个宽泛的判断, 而===则较为严格, 它要求类型也必须一致,  废话少说, 直接撸代码:

<html>
<body><script>
var a = "1";
var b = '1';
var c = 1;if(a == b && b == c)
{alert("yes1");
}if(a === b)
{alert("yes2");
}if(b === c)
{alert("yes3");
}
</script></body>
</html>

结果是有yes1和yes2弹框, 没有yes3弹框。

js, 你好任性。

js中的==和===相关推荐

  1. 在js中使用HashMap数据结构,在js中使用K,V数据结构

    首先是定义一个HashMap方法,做基类(复制在js中即可,然后引用) //简单的哈希表,begin function HashMap() {/** Map 大小 * */var size = 0;/ ...

  2. [JavaScript] 探索JS中的函数秘密

    函数长啥样? 把一些要重复使用的内容封装到函数内. function foo(title) {console.log(title) } foo('title') foo('dust') foo('he ...

  3. 在node.js中,使用基于ORM架构的Sequelize,操作mysql数据库之增删改查

    Sequelize是一个基于promise的关系型数据库ORM框架,这个库完全采用JavaScript开发并且能够用在Node.JS环境中,易于使用,支持多SQL方言(dialect),.它当前支持M ...

  4. 在JS中最常看到切最容易迷惑的语法(转)

    发现一篇JS中比较容易迷惑的语法的解释,挺有用的,转载下,与大家分享: js中大括号有四种语义作用 语义1,组织复合语句,这是最常见的 Js代码  if( condition ) { //... }e ...

  5. js去el的map_转:el表达式获取map对象的内容 js中使用el表达式 js 中使用jstl 实现 session.removeattribute...

    原文链接: 总结: el表达式获取map对象的内容 后端: HashMap map1 = new HashMap(); map1.put("key1","lzsb&quo ...

  6. js中substr,substring,indexOf,lastIndexOf的用法

    js中substr,substring,indexOf,lastIndexOf等的用法 1.substr substr(start,length)表示从start位置开始,截取length长度的字符串 ...

  7. js中的各种宽高以及位置总结

    在javascript中操作dom节点让其运动的时候,常常会涉及到各种宽高以及位置坐标等概念,如果不能很好地理解这些属性所代表的意义,就不能理解js的运动原理,同时,由于这些属性概念较多,加上浏览器之 ...

  8. WKWebView Safari调试、JS互调、加载进度条、JS中alert、confirm、prompt

    主要内容 Safari调试 swift/OC与JS互调 增加加载进度条 支持JS中alert.confirm.prompt Safari调试 设置 -> safari --> 高级,开启J ...

  9. 彻底理解js中this

    相关博文:http://blog.csdn.net/libin_1/article/details/49996815 彻底理解js中this的指向,不必硬背. 首先必须要说的是,this的指向在函数定 ...

  10. 彻底理解js中this的指向

    首先必须要说的是,this的指向在函数定义的时候是确定不了的,只有函数执行的时候才能确定this到底指向谁,实际上this的最终指向的是那个调用它的对象(这句话有些问题,后面会解释为什么会有问题,虽然 ...

最新文章

  1. Python 循环控制语句-break/continue
  2. 小明分享| SigmastarSSD201环境搭建及源码编译
  3. python简单小游戏代码_一个简单的python小游戏---七彩同心圆
  4. .net开发人员应该知道(一)
  5. Android中的消息机制
  6. JavaFX UI控件教程(十二)之List View
  7. 4个万无一失的技巧让您开始使用JBoss BRMS 6.0.3
  8. 经典冒泡排序及其优化
  9. 蝗虫算法java代码_蝗虫搜索算法 蝗虫算法:蝗虫优化算法是模拟自然界蝗虫种群捕食行为而提出的一 联合开发网 - pudn.com...
  10. data.name.toLowerCase() is not a function问题
  11. mysql盲注ascii_[翻译]关于通过对8bit的ascii做右位移提高mysql盲注效率
  12. Java 打印某年某月的月日历
  13. 程序员如何写简历?程序员写出牛逼简历的5大技巧
  14. meta-inf java_jar包中的META-INF 文件夹是干嘛的?
  15. 卡方检验(Chi-square test/Chi-Square Goodness-of-Fit Test)
  16. 支付宝支付开发—当面付条码支付和扫码支付
  17. 10大关键词解读中国互联网五年间创新飞跃在哪里
  18. 2018年最流行的十大编程语言,有你用的吗?
  19. 【自定义控件】仿支付宝支付动画
  20. TiDB 6.0 新特性

热门文章

  1. 支持百亿数据场景,海量高性能列式数据库HiStore技术架构解析
  2. Benefits from music
  3. 发现自己的长处,深入自己擅长的事情
  4. DOS窗口命令--实用完整版
  5. libuv 原理_进程 | libuv中文教程
  6. window.name 跨域实现原理及实例
  7. 操作系统(一)什么是操作系统
  8. PCL小工具二:使用kitti的GT(ground truth)建立激光点云地图
  9. l05173芯片针脚图_芯片引脚定义
  10. 应用层协议的设计与实现